2016 Fiat 500 gets updated styling inside and out

Fiat has revealed the updated 2016 Fiat 500, which it says has received no fewer than 1,800 detail changes, but you probably can’t spot all of them.

It’s hard to believe that the current Fiat 500 has been on the market for eight years. On the outside, the 2016 Fiat 500’s styling doesn’t get a dramatic update, but you’ll notice the revised headlights, new daytime running lights and a slightly modified grille. There’s also a bit more chrome on the 2016 500’s face. The rear of the updated 500 gets redesigned taillights and a new bumper. New alloy wheel designs are also part of the update.

Inside the biggest update is the addition of the Uconnect infotainment system that is accessed via a 5-inch touchscreen and there’s also a 7-inch TFT display in the instrument cluster. The 500’s seats have also been updated and buyers can choose from new seat fabrics.

The updated 2016 Fiat 500 will go on sale this fall.
